Q: Is 4,444,036 a Prime Number?
A: No, 4,444,036 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 4444036 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 31 62 124 35,839 71,678 143,356 1,111,009 2,222,018 and 4,444,036, with no remainder.
Since 4,444,036 cannot be divided by just 1 and 4,444,036, it is not a prime number.
